"Funny things happen at funerals. Very funny, comical, human things. You may not laugh, but it’s all mixed up together." ~playwright Thomas Bradshaw
This Blank on Blank deals with a simple question about man’s ability to move on: is there a right way to deal with death and tragedy? Can you find laughs--or even love--at a funeral? Well, one man’s answers come to us from BOMB magazine in an interview by cultural critic Margo Jefferson. It’s with award-winning playwright Thomas Bradshaw. Here is Bradshaw's take on some of the eternal questions of life.
